Hello, I found this board while searching the net for my issue at hand
I have 2 issues
1-
There is this guy, he will not leave me alone, I put him on Ignore everyday. and when I wake up, I find he’s sent me a message and is no longer in my ignore list.2-
Since I sometimes leave my messenger logged in over night and when I wake up, I’ve been logged out, the message says to log back in with the 3 options, signin troubles, try again, and create user.I changed my password several times and this is still happening, if anyone has any ideas to offer or a fix for this, I’d really appreciate it, as I surely hate the idea of creating a new ID.
thanks
Diane in PA

It also sounds like he’s got your password and just adds himself back to your list. So I would scan your system for Magic PS and any number of other trojans, especially keyloggers, that might be on your system.
